Evaluation Metrics That Matter Here

  • Automatic admission is available via 2.50+ GPA (or GED 50+) with 20 ACT/950 SAT, or 3.00+ GPA test-optional - first-year applicants face no essay and no recommendation letter requirement.
  • All coursework runs on a 6-week block schedule (one or two classes per block, then a 1-week break) rather than a standard semester - a structural difference that affects pacing, not just calendar length.
  • Transfer students can bring up to 90 credits via block transfer, with a free pre-enrollment transcript evaluation.
  • Spalding was founded in 1814 by the Sisters of Charity of Nazareth and is known academically for Nursing and for its Auerbach School of Occupational Therapy, including a Post-Professional OTD with trimester entry and an OTD/MBA dual-degree track.

Your 2026 Admissions Roadmap for Spalding

Inclusive Strategy: Success & Transfer

Spalding's open-access model means the real strategic decisions happen after enrollment: course planning, advising, and whether to transfer later.

Hit the automatic-admission thresholds and skip the essay entirely

Spalding grants automatic admission with a 2.50+ cumulative GPA (or GED of 50+) paired with a 20 ACT or 950 SAT combined, OR a 3.00+ GPA under test-optional review - and first-year applicants face no personal essay and no letter of recommendation requirement at all. A student with a GPA under 3.0 should specifically target the 20 ACT / 950 SAT combined threshold rather than agonizing over supplemental writing that Spalding doesn't even ask for; effort is far better spent on a single retest than on essay polish here.

Plan coursework around the 6-week block schedule, not a standard semester

Spalding runs on a block schedule: students take one or two classes per 6-week term followed by a 1-week break, rather than the standard 15-week semester most applicants expect. A student coming from a traditional high school schedule should ask admissions specifically how course load and financial aid disbursement work under this compressed block system before committing to a course sequence, since study pacing and drop/add timelines are compressed relative to a typical semester and catch transfer students off guard.

Use the up-to-90-credit block transfer if coming from another institution

Spalding allows block transfer of up to 90 credits with a free transcript evaluation completed before enrollment - a materially generous transfer allowance most comparably-sized private universities don't match. A transfer applicant should request the free transcript evaluation as an explicit, named service at the point of application (not simply submit transcripts and wait), since getting the evaluation done pre-enrollment lets a student see exactly how close they are to junior/senior standing before paying a cent in tuition.

OT-track applicants: know the Auerbach School of Occupational Therapy's distinct doctoral pathway

Spalding's Auerbach School of Occupational Therapy offers a Post-Professional OTD that licensed OT practitioners can start at the beginning of any trimester, including a dual OTD/MBA option aimed at healthcare entrepreneurship and leadership. A current or aspiring OT practitioner should ask specifically about trimester entry points and the dual-degree option by name, since these aren't part of the standard undergraduate application cycle and are easy to miss if a student only researches Spalding's undergraduate admissions page.

Is a Spalding Degree Worth It?

Spalding offers a rigorous academic environment, but 'worth it' is a personal calculation of cost, program fit, and outcomes. The figures below are a starting point.

The average household income among admitted students is $55,900, with a graduate unemployment rate of 3.35%.

How much does a degree from Spalding Cost?

The sticker price is $43,474/year, but the average net price students actually pay, after Pell and federal grants, is typically much lower.

35.6% of students receive a Pell Grant and 57.4% take federal loans at Spalding. File your FAFSA early and list Spalding as a choice to be considered for both.

How much does a Spalding Graduate earn?

Median earnings 10 years after enrollment (roughly 4–6 years post-graduation) are $49,438. That's about 22% above the U.S. median graduate income.
